Italy gives up historic buildings for use as deluxe hotels

The first to be offered is the Villa Tolomei, a crumbling Renaissance jewel at Marignolle in the Tuscan hills just outside Florence, which is to become an "elegant super deluxe hotel". The terms of the lease - under a scheme that emulates the Spanish system of Paradors - are to be published in the next two weeks.
